Enhanced transmission for ultra-low-power nonlinear optics experiments using tapered optical fibers in Rubidium vapor

Not Accessible

Your library or personal account may give you access

Abstract

We have studied transmission degradation for sub-wavelength diameter Tapered Optical Fibers in Rubidium vapor. A heating strategy is shown to reduce degradation, thereby enhancing the ability to perform ultra-low-power nonlinear optics experiments.
